Brick Hardscaping in Greenwich, CT
Brick hardscaping services involve the installation and repair of durable brick features that enhance the functionality and appearance of residential outdoor spaces. Projects commonly include creating pat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and outdoor fireplaces. Homeowners often seek these services to add aesthetic appeal, improve outdoor usability, or increase property value. Before requesting brick hardscaping work, property owners should consider factors such as the desired design style, the intended use of the space, and any existing landscape features that may influence the project’s scope and materials.
Understanding the different types of brick materials, such as clay or concrete, and their suitability for specific applications is important for homeowners. Additionally, knowing about the necessary preparation steps, including site grading and foundation work, can help set realistic expectations. Clear communication about project goals, budget considerations, and maintenance preferences can ensure the completed hardscape aligns with the property owner’s vision and functional needs.

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ping can be used for patios, walkways, steps, and retaining walls to enhance outdoor spaces.
How durable is brick for outdoor use? Brick is a long-lasting material that withstands weather conditions when properly installed and maintained.
What design options are available with brick hardscaping? Brick offers a variety of patterns, colors, and styles to complement different property aesthetics.
Is brick hardscaping suitable for sloped properties? Yes, brick can be used to create level surfaces and retaining walls on sloped terrains.
